Meta Spark Studio: Crafting Augmented Reality Experiences
The Power of Low-Code Prototyping
Meta Spark Studio empowers creators to build and publish AR experiences without requiring extensive coding knowledge. Its low-code approach accelerates development, allowing business users to prototype solutions rapidly. Imagine designing interactive filters, virtual try-on experiences, or location-based AR campaigns—all within Meta Spark Studio’s intuitive interface. The ability to iterate quickly reduces bottlenecks to innovation, making AR accessible to a wider audience.

Behind the Builds: Creators Unleash Their Imagination
“The Story of Undying Love in Bangkok”
In this Behind the Build episode, creators Florian Sabatier, Opas Sang, and Pakawat “Earth” Korsriphitakku share their journey in bringing a famous Thai ghost story to life in AR. Using animation, 3D objects, and scripting, they crafted an immersive effect that transports users into the heart of Bangkok’s supernatural tale. The Meta Quest 3’s hand-tracking technology allowed them to animate 3D objects seamlessly, creating an eerie and captivating experience. SparkSL and Dynamic Instantiation
Meta Spark’s scripting language, SparkSL, enables creators to customize effects further. From shaders to dynamic instantiation, SparkSL provides fine-grained control. Imagine creating custom visual effects, manipulating lighting, or dynamically spawning objects based on user interactions. Meta Spark Player: Testing and Storing AR Creations
Mirror Effects from Computer to Mobile
Meta Spark Player bridges the gap between development and testing. Creators can mirror effects from their computers to mobile devices, allowing them to see how their AR creations will appear in the real world.
